Resistance Commands
Resistance commands program the output resistance.
[SOURce:]RESistance[:LEVel][:IMMediate][:AMPLitude] <value>, (@<chanlist>)
[SOURce:]RESistance[:LEVel][:IMMediate][:AMPLitude]? [MIN|MAX,] (@<chanlist>)
[SOURce:]RESistance[:LEVel]:TRIGgered[:AMPLitude] <value>, (@<chanlist>)
[SOURce:]RESistance[:LEVel]:TRIGgered[:AMPLitude]? [MIN|MAX,] (@<chanlist>)
Sets the immediate resistance level and the triggered resistance level. The triggered level is a stored
value that will be programmed when a Step transient is triggered. Units are in ohms.
Parameter Typical Return
- 40 mΩ to +1 Ω|MIN|MAX, *RST 0 (N6781A/85A)
80 mΩ to +8 kΩ|MIN|MAX, *RST 8 kΩ (N679xA)
0 (zero)
Specifies a resistance of 0.5 ohms: RES 0.5, (@1)
Specifies a triggered resistance of 1 ohms: RES:TRIG 0.5, (@1)
l The query returns the programmed resistance in the form +n.nnnnnnE+nn for each channel spe-
cified. Multiple responses are separated by commas.

[SOURce:]RESistance:MODE FIXed|STEP|LIST|ARB, (@<chanlist>)
[SOURce:]RESistance:MODE? (@<chanlist>)
Sets the transient mode. This determines what happens to the resistance when the transient system
is initiated and triggered.
FIXed - keeps the resistance at its immediate value.
STEP - steps the resistance to the triggered level when a trigger occurs.
LIST - causes the resistance to follow the list values when a trigger occurs.
ARB - causes the resistance to follow the arbitrary waveform values when a trigger occurs.
Parameter Typical Return
FIXed|STEP|LIST|ARB, *RST FIXed FIX, STEP, LIST, or ARB
Sets the resistance mode to Step: RES:MODE STEP, (@1)
